Handicap Ramp Construction Questions
What types of handicap ramps are available? There are various options including straight, L-shaped, and modular ramps designed to fit different property layouts and accessibility needs.
What materials are used for handicap ramp construction? Common materials include treated wood, aluminum, and steel, chosen for durability and safety in outdoor environments.
Are custom ramp designs possible? Yes, ramps can be customized to match specific space requirements and accessibility requirements for residential or commercial properties.
What should property owners consider before installing a handicap ramp? It's important to evaluate space availability, slope requirements, and surface stability to ensure safe and effective access.
